| MediaMikesMichael A. SmithA cross between "Meatballs" and "Stand by Me," "Age of Summerhood" makes great use of its outdoor locations to show kids as they are rarely portrayed on screen: as kids. |
| Toronto StarPeter HowellOn the plus side, he seems to have documented every single thing that happened to him. On the negative side, none of it was terribly exciting. |
| Globe and MailJennie PunterDespite its shortcomings, Summerhood is an earnest effort from a first-time director who clearly enjoys stoking and poking at his campfire memories. |
| Jam! MoviesLiz BraunThe movie has none of the awkwardness or clunky moments you might expect from a low-budget first feature. |
| eye WEEKLYAdam NaymanLet the record show that it's better than Hot Tub Time Machine, though that's not much of a compliment. |
